Explore a comprehensive lecture series from MIT's Independent Activities Period, covering essential computer science topics over 10 hours. Dive into subjects like shell programming, vim editing, data wrangling, command-line environments, version control with git, debugging, profiling, metaprogramming, security, and cryptography. Gain practical skills and knowledge through a series of 11 lectures, concluding with a Q&A session to reinforce your understanding of these fundamental computer science concepts.
